Output 8595b94205331ed124a78aa280e148de98f0cd6c1ed81fa48e7d0c166fcd7df0:5

value
21730353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c723fe57058a195d9c1586f7cfebe85a2d962d0c OP_EQUAL
address
3KqyWbFNkAY68QnvGNdot8Y9HygaT2eGZR
transaction
8595b94205331ed124a78aa280e148de98f0cd6c1ed81fa48e7d0c166fcd7df0
confirmations
1500
spent
true